Latest Patents

Chikazawa's latest patents include a "Continuous mill plant for rolling steel plates" and a "Method and apparatus for manufacturing cold-rolled steel strip." The continuous mill plant is designed to roll steel plates with a maximum to minimum rolling speed ratio of at least 3.0 but no more than 10.0. This innovation enhances the continuous rated output of the electric motor driving the rolling mill. The cold-rolled strip manufacturing apparatus links a continuous cold reduction mill with a continuous annealing furnace. It features a tension-leveller-type scale breaker that elongates hot-rolled breakdown by 2 to 7 percent, along with a scale scrubbing brush unit and an immersion-type continuous pickling tank. This apparatus effectively descalers the hot-rolled strip coil by breaking the mill scale formed on its surface.
